Understanding OneDrive For Business 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Understanding OneDrive For Business • OneDrive for Business is the main place that individual users can store their personal work files. To reiterate, these are the work files that you work on as an individual in your organization. • It is important to remember that these files belong to your organization and your organization will have access to them. • Do not save your personal documents and files here; use OneDrive for that. • The topics covered in this chapter are as follows: • History and background of OneDrive for Business • Getting into OneDrive for Business • Parts of OneDrive for Business • How is OneDrive for Business different from OneDrive 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H History and background of OneDrive for Business • OneDrive for Business, not to be confused with OneDrive, is the business version of OneDrive that is connected to or purchased via Office 365. • It is the replacement for Microsoft's SharePoint Workspace. • It was released in the first version of Office 365 and has continued to evolve like the rest of Office 365. • Like OneDrive, OneDrive for Business is a file-hosting and sync service created by and hosted by Microsoft. Both have a sync app that allows you to sync your documents to your computers and a mobile app for accessing your files on your mobile device. • Unlike OneDrive, OneDrive for Business can only be accessed online via the Office 365 portal. OneDrive is accessed via the consumer portal of https:/ / www. msn. com/ en- in/ , https:/ /outlook. live. com/ owa/ , https:/ / outlook. live. com/ owa/ , and so on. • Both were formally named SkyDrive and SkyDrive for Business until a lawsuit forced a renaming to OneDrive and OneDrive for Business in 2014.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Getting into OneDrive for Business • Once you are logged into the Office 365 portal, you can get to OneDrive for Business. • You have two options for accessing it: via the Office 365 Home or via the app launcher. I know it says OneDrive • but it is really OneDrive for Business: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Getting into OneDrive for Business • If you happen to be in a different part of Office 365, you can click on the app launcher then on the OneDrive button. • You can open it in a new tab, instead of the current tab, by hovering over the OneDrive button, clicking on the open menu, then on Open in new tab: • Either way you go, you will land in your Files in your OneDrive for Business: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• Just like every other part of Office 365, each application has a few parts: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business #1 Search box • Start typing in the box and the system will start offering you some preliminary results: • Click on the See more results link at the bottom of the preliminary results dropdown and the main window portion of the page will show more results • The Filters pane will also open on the right side with options for filtering down your search results by the modified date, the file types, and/or by author(s)/contributor(s). • If you want to search in SharePoint, there is a link at the very bottom of the main window that will allow you to do just that! 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• To clear the search box, click in the search box then on the X on the right-hand side of the box: • Before you click on the search box, there is text in it that says Search everything. • Everything means all of your files and folders. • This does not include results from SharePoint: • The search capability is very powerful. So powerful, in fact, that you may get back too many results. • The search will search the title of the file, web page, or site, the URL, the text contained within, and any attached metadata.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business #2 Your OneDrive navigation • Clicking on these opens the selected option in the main window. • Files shows all your files and folders and is the default landing location when you enter OneDrive for Business. Recent • Recent shows all your recent file activity: • You don't need to search a document you were recently working on. • You can go to it using the Recent tab.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business Shared • Shared shows files shared with you and by you. • Files that were shared with you (see the Shared with me tab) will not show in your Files: • Seeing files called out as being shared by you (see the Shared by me tab) is useful when you need to remember who you shared what with and in situations where you need to remove or modify those permissions.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business Recycle bin • The Recycle bin shows files that were deleted by you. • Files stay here for 30 days, unless you decide to delete the file or empty the recycle bin, then they are moved to the second-stage recycle bin where they stay for another 30 days unless they are manually deleted. • After that, they may not be recoverable unless your organization has a backup solution in place. • You can go to the second-stage bin by clicking on the Second-stage recycle bin link at the bottom of the main window: • Click on the link next to the file you want and choose Restore or Delete from the action bar: • You can restore or delete individual files in this way.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business #3 Sites navigation • This section gives you options for seeing files from whichever site you select. • You can also see more sites if you don't see the site you want listed and/or create a new site using the links at the bottom of the section. #4 Extra options • The links here take you to different places to do different things. • The first link opens a new tab in your browser and takes you to the Admin Center for OneDrive for Business.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• The second link opens another tab where you can get apps for Windows and your devices, even Xbox One! • The last link returns you to the classic look and feel of OneDrive for Business: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business #5 Action bar • This bar is subject to change. • It shows options based on where you are in your OneDrive and based on whether you have chosen an item or not. Here are some examples. • If you haven't clicked on anything, you get actions you can perform on the entire library: • If you clicked on a file or folder, you get options based on what you selected: • The files have three options more than the folders.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• #6 View options and detail pane • View Options gives you choices for how you want files to be displayed. • You can look at your files in the List (which is the default view), Compact list, or Tiles views: • What you see in the details pane depends on whether you have not chosen anything, have chosen one file, or folder, or chosen multiple files.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• If you have not chosen anything, you can see the Activity in this library: • If you chose one file, you can see details for that file, including a preview of the file, the file's permissions, properties, and so forth. • You may be able to change the properties in the Properties section if you have at least contributing permission for the file. • If you have full control permission over the file, then you will be able to change the file's permission via the Manage access link in the Has access section: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• To see more details, click on the More details link at the bottom of the pane. • To collapse this section, click on More details again: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business • If you choose a folder, you can see details for that folder, the folder's permissions, properties, and so forth. • You may be able to change the properties in the Properties section if you have at least contributing permission for the folder. • If you have full control permission over the folder, then you will be able to change the folder's permission via the Manage access link in the Has access section: • To see more details, click on the More details link at the bottom of the pane: • If you choose multiple files and/or folders, you only see that you selected multiple things but no details.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Parts of OneDrive for Business #7 Main window • This part of the page shows whatever is clicked on from the OneDrive or Sites navigation or shows the search results if the See more results link at the bottom of the preliminary search box is clicked.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H How is OneDrive for Business different from OneDrive • As mentioned earlier in this chapter, OneDrive for Business and OneDrive are different in a few ways. Let's look at those differences in more detail. • The biggest difference is where you log in. • OneDrive is a consumer product which is linked to your Microsoft account, formally known as Live, and OneDrive for Business is linked to Office 365, the Business version, not the Home version.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H How is OneDrive for Business different from OneDrive • Logging into OneDrive for Business must be done through the Office 365 portal. • Logging in to OneDrive is done through a Microsoft consumer page such as https:/ / www. msn. com/ en-in/. • You can sign into your Microsoft account or choose OneDrive to sign into OneDrive faster: • The one place where you can get into either is via the OneDrive site: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H How is OneDrive for Business different from OneDrive • The look and feel of OneDrive is also different than that of OneDrive for Business. • Here is what OneDrive looks like as of April 2019: 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H How is OneDrive for Business different from OneDrive • Also, the sync clients for each are two different colors. • There is blue for OneDrive for Business and white for OneDrive: • The last difference you should know about as an end user is that there is no way to log into one from the other. • They are separate now and more than likely, they will always be separate, which makes sense if you really stop and think about it. • You really wouldn't want your personal files mixed up with your business files that your organization has the right to access at any time. 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1445 H Thank You​ ​ 11/6/23 30/09/2023 UJ –CECS CCCS 100 1st Term 1st 1445 H 1445 H Term
